Gas pumps feel the pain, too
Monday, May 12, 2008 | 12:01 am
Priming the pump: Some mom-and-pop gas stations in rural areas say their old-style pumps aren't able to handle prices above $3.99 a gallon. That's OK; neither are most drivers.
Banana seat optional: No doubt fears of $4-a-gallon gas have something to do with it, but bicycles are now a more popular option for running errands and commuting. The Herald's Sarah Jackson shows us the friendly features of the Electra Bike Co.'s Townie casual cycle.
We hope bike makers have improved their marketing savvy since the '70s, when Young Buzz got his first three-speed Sears Free Spirit bike for his 13th birthday and rode with pride until he learned that Free Spirit was the same name given a line of bras.
Crosby, Stills, Nash & Kiaphila: A biologist and music fan has named a newly discovered species of trapdoor spider, Myrmekiaphila neilyoungi, for the legendary folk rock singer. Usually, The Buzz is pretty well-versed in rock music, but we haven't the slightest idea who Myrme Kiaphila is, unless he was the drummer for Earth, Wind and Fire.
